Fiat Novo AC not cooling

I own a 2011 Fiat Novo with a gasoline engine. Recently, the air conditioning has stopped cooling and doesn't switch on at all. I suspect a defect in the valves. Can anyone assist?

Summary of the thread

The air conditioning in a 2011 Fiat Novo stopped cooling and wouldn't switch on, leading to a suspicion of defective valves. A suggestion was made to check for a refrigerant leak, pressure switch, or AC relay issues. Ultimately, the problem was confirmed to be a faulty valve, which was resolved at a workshop.
